Antonio Maraini
Summary
Antonio Maraini is a human[1]. He was born in Rome[2]. He was born on April 5, 1886[3]. He passed away in Florence[4]. He died on May 23, 1963[5]. He worked as an artist[6], art critic[7], and politician[8].
